Welcome to a new world of adventure. Your new MicroXplore LCD microscope is capable of capturing detailed, high resolution, full-color images and movies of the microscopic world, both with your eyes and with the included CMOS chip and LCD screen. Examine details at high powers of 40x-640x with the included eyepieces, or 24x-960x with the LCD screen.

Capturing Images Press the Mode button a few times until the microscope is in Camera mode, indicated by a small picture of a camera in the top left corner (Figure 8).
